acquisition of seed longevity

Term ID
GO:0140547
Synonyms
Definition
The acquisition of seed longevity is the ordered series of events during seed development, that prevent embryo deterioration and ROS damage and thus contribute to seed viability over time or in response to adverse environmental conditions. These events include protective (e.g. production of glassy cytoplasm ) and repair (e.g. oxidative stress responses) processes. 26637538
